Ebony name Meaning and Origin

Editor by Lisa Rudy | Checked by Laura Gordon

What is the meaning

Ebony is a name that has been around for centuries and has a rich history and meaning. The name is derived from the dark, dense wood of the ebony tree, which is native to Africa and India. Ebony wood is known for its strength, durability, and beauty, and has been used for centuries to make furniture, musical instruments, and other decorative items. The name Ebony has been used for both boys and girls, but it is more commonly given to girls. It has been a popular name in African American communities since the 1970s, and has also gained popularity in other cultures around the world. The meaning of the name Ebony is often associated with the color black, which is the color of the ebony wood. Origin

The name Ebony is derived from the Latin word ebenus, which means "ebony tree." The ebenus tree is a type of hardwood tree that produces a dark, black wood. The name Ebony has been used as a given name since the 19th century.
